N2 - Radio frequency interference (RFI) may degrade the quality of remote sensing images acquired by spaceborne synthetic aperture radar (SAR). In the interferometric wide-swath mode of the Sentinel-1 satellite, the SAR receiver may capture multiple types of RFI signals within a single observation period, which is referred to as heterogeneous RFI, increasing the complexity of interference detection and mitigation. This article proposes a heterogeneous interference mitigation method based on subimage segmentation and local spectral features analysis. The proposed method divides the original single look complex image into multiple subimages along the range direction, enhancing the representation of interference features in the range frequency domain. Spectral analysis is then performed on each subimage to detect and mitigate interference. Finally, the image after RFI mitigation is reconstructed by stitching the subimages together. Experiments were conducted using simulated interference data generated from LuTan-1 and measured interference data from Sentinel-1. The results demonstrate that the proposed method can effectively mitigate RFI artifacts in various typical interference scenarios and restore the obscured ground object information in the images.
